About Da Vinci Science
Da Vinci Science is a public high school in EL Segundo, CA, part of Da Vinci Science District, serving approximately 546 students in grades 9th-12th with a 20.2: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 8.5 out of 10 and ranks #784 of 9,539 schools in CA. State assessment records show 56%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2018-2024) and 83%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2018-2024).
